BRIEF: Stay Work Play adds seven board members [The New Hampshire Union Leader, Manchester :: ]


(New Hampshire Union Leader Via Acquire Media NewsEdge) Aug. 07--MANCHESTER -- Stay Work Play, a New Hampshire nonprofit organization to encourage more 20 and 30 somethings to work and reside in the state after graduation, recently added seven new members to its board of directors: Andrew B. Palumbo, assistant vice president of enrollment management and director of admissions, Plymouth State University; Carmen Lorentz, director, New Hampshire Division of Economic Development; E.J. Powers, executive vice president, Montagne Communications; Kristyn Van Ostern, associate vice chancellor and chief financial officer, Community College System of New Hampshire; Mark M. Brown, director of corporate potential, Grappone Automotive Group; Melinda Treadwell, vice president for academic affairs, Antioch University New England; and Travis York, president and CEO, GYK Antler.
